Rolls-Royce Electric Aircraft Becomes World’s Fastest

Rolls-Royce’s “Spirit of Innovation” has officially become the world’s fastest all-electric aircraft with the recent confirmation of two speed records. Now verified by the Fédération Aéronautique Internationale (FAI), the aircraft was recorded at 555.9 km/h (345.4 MPH) over 3 kilometers (1.86 miles), 213.04 km/h (132 MPH) faster than the previous record-holder. Rolls-Royce Opens World’s Largest Aerospace Testbed

Rolls-Royce officially opened the doors to its new 7,500-square-meter (80,729-square-foot) testbed facility in Derby, U.K., last week. Called Testbed 80, the testbed can collect data for more than 10,000 different engine parameters and detect vibrations at a rate of up to 200,000 samples per second.
